Multivariable logistic regression model for ICU admission (viruses compared to A/H3) N = 549

Outcome variable Independent variable (IV; n = number of patients with IV in ICU/number of patients with IV in model) Unadjusted OR (95% CI) Unadjusted P-value Adjusted OR (95% CI) Adjusted P-value
ICU admission (n = 66) Virus (reference: A/H3) (n = 18/173)
A/H1 (n = 18/63) 0.344 (1.655–7.167) 0.001 2.561 (1.188–5.520) 0.016
INF-B (n = 8/72) 1.076 (0.445–2.601) 0.870 0.986 (0.401–2.425) 0.975
hMPV (n = 4/80) 0.453 (0.148–1.386) 0.165 0.405 (0.131–1.259) 0.118
PIV (n = 7/66) 1.021 (0.406–2.571) 0.964 0.931 (0.360–2.406) 0.883
RSV (n = 11/95) 1.128 (0.509–2.500) 0.767 0.997 (0.439–2.261) 0.994
COPD (n = 18/92) 1.311 (0.975–7.763) 0.073 2.762 (1.438–5.306) 0.002
Female (n = 26/269) 0.635 (0.496–0.812) <0.001 0.635 (0.367–1.098) 0.104
Age group (reference: 18–49 years, n = 22/127)
50–64 years (n = 23/146) 0.968 (0.714–1.313) 0.836 0.794 (0.404–1.560) 0.503
65+ years (n = 21/276) 0.495 (0.370–0.663) <0.001 0.356 (0.177–0.715) 0.004
